Transaction 65ba9425445082fbb6c4fe11dd6f5b9668ff9d5918d7fe63481f67be59b6b873
1 Input
1 Output
-
65ba9425445082fbb6c4fe11dd6f5b9668ff9d5918d7fe63481f67be59b6b873:0
- value
- 28899890
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ba8fe78331705d9f527b54e16b1e25b2b9bd529
- address
- ltc1qdw50u7pnzuzanaf8k48pdv0ztv4eh4ffufax6n